Heat treatment involves controlled heating and cooling of materials, which alters their physical and sometimes chemical properties. This process can improve hardness, strength, and elasticity, making it particularly valuable for products used in demanding environments, such as commercial kitchens or dining settings. Benefits of Heat Treatment in Kitchenware Production

The advantages of employing heat treatment in the production of tableware and kitchenware are manifold:

  • Enhanced Durability: Heat-treated products exhibit better wear resistance, crucial for items like cookware and utensils.
  • Improved Performance: The right treatment can enhance the cooking properties of metal materials, making them more efficient.
  • Cost Efficiency: By increasing product lifespan, manufacturers can reduce waste and lower replacement costs.
  • Compliance with Standards: Many international markets require adherence to strict quality standards, which heat treatment helps achieve.
